NEWCASTLE, England (Reuters) - Newcastle United manager Rafa Benitez was left fuming at the referee after his side conceded an equaliser late into stoppage time as they were held 1-1 by Leeds United in the Championship on Friday.

"I'm not down, I am just so upset, because there have been so many games where I see things I don’t understand," said the former Liverpool and Real Madrid manager, referring to the decision to add on five minutes at the end of the game.
